The finale wasn't that bad, I must say. The animation was really good this episode. My only complaint is that the whole series was way too fast and strayed far from the manga. I'm hoping for a more original ending from CLAMP, and a longer manga than the anime, but for a 24 episode series, they did pretty good.

There were many things that were changed and many things this anime needed to make it complete, imho. I know for a fact Ioryogi and Kobato have more of a relationship than they conveyed in the anime. I'd really like some more of their story in the manga :/ That was a disappointment for me. But I guess when you start an anime series when the manga has less than 20 chapters out, that's what you get. Also, Kobato and Fujimoto's whole ordeal was too tedious in the anime. She's messing around more than half the time, then it's like "Epiphany! I love Fujimoto!" It wasn't well-balanced in the anime. What's weird is that she gets 500 candy for every person she heals apparently. In the manga it's not even fall yet, I don't think, and she has like 8 candy in her bottle. But what's odd is it's tedious in the anime, not the manga.

I guess the fact that I'm reading the manga holds me back from really enjoying this series. It's like a good fanfiction though, the anime. I've been dying to see some Fujimoto x Kobato huggles in the manga, and I just don't get any ):

As for the final episode itself, pretty good. Nothing much to complain about. I'm glad it didn't end with Kobato never meeting Fujimoto again, because I'm too much of a sap for that. I'd die, and say this whole series was worthless for such a ending. So yeah, I'm glad for that. And like I said, the animation was better in this episode than any other.

So yeah. Overall, a 6.5/10. Everything leading up to this moment was really lame, so I think the finale made it better for me. I just love this manga and the anime had some worthwhile material for me to edit with, too. :mrgreen:
